Different robot types cater to specific needs, with articulated robots excelling in flexibility and reach, while Cartesian robots are ideal for precise, linear movements. Gantry robots, on the other hand, offer significant payload capacity and reach, making them suitable for larger-scale maintenance operations. Several key factors are driving the rapid expansion of the manufacturing maintenance robots market. Firstly, the increasing demand for higher productivity and reduced operational costs in manufacturing is a major catalyst. Robots offer significant improvements in efficiency by automating repetitive and time-consuming maintenance tasks, leading to faster turnaround times and minimizing production downtime. Secondly, the rising complexity of modern manufacturing equipment necessitates more sophisticated maintenance solutions. Robots can access confined spaces and perform intricate tasks with greater precision and consistency than human workers, enhancing maintenance quality. Thirdly, the growing emphasis on workplace safety is promoting the adoption of robots for hazardous maintenance tasks, minimizing risks to human personnel. This is particularly true in environments with high temperatures, chemicals, or heavy machinery. Furthermore, advancements in robotics technology, including improved sensor technology, AI-powered predictive maintenance capabilities, and more user-friendly interfaces, are making robots more accessible and effective for a wider range of maintenance applications. The integration of robots into existing manufacturing systems is becoming simpler and more cost-effective, further driving market expansion. Finally, government initiatives and industry collaborations aimed at promoting automation and Industry 4.0 are providing further support to the market's growth.
Despite the significant growth potential, the manufacturing maintenance robots market faces certain challenges. High initial investment costs associated with robot procurement, installation, and integration can be a significant barrier for smaller manufacturers. The complexity of integrating robots into existing manufacturing systems requires specialized expertise and can lead to substantial implementation costs and potential disruptions to production. Furthermore, the need for skilled personnel to operate and maintain the robots presents a challenge, requiring investment in training and development programs. Concerns about job displacement due to automation can also lead to resistance from workers and require careful management and communication strategies. The lack of standardization in robot interfaces and communication protocols can also hinder interoperability and create integration challenges. Lastly, the safety of working alongside robots in maintenance scenarios requires careful consideration and the implementation of robust safety measures to prevent accidents. Addressing these challenges through government support, industry collaboration, and technological advancements is crucial for the continued growth and widespread adoption of manufacturing maintenance robots.
